Big Fat Greek Baked Beans

Ingredients

  • 1 pound of Gigante beans (or Hakan tay beans)
  • Water
  • 2 bay leaves
  • Diced red onion
  • Sliced or minced garlic
  • Tomato sauce and tomato paste (or fresh chopped tomatoes)
  • Honey (Greek pine honey preferred, or clover honey)
  • Freshly chopped dill
  • Olive oil
  • Kosher salt
  • Freshly ground black pepper
  • Cayenne pepper
  • Red wine vinegar
  • Water (or chicken stock)
  • Feta cheese

Instructions

  1. Soak Gigante beans in water overnight.
  2. Drain soaked beans and add to a pot with fresh water and bay leaves. Bring to a boil, then simmer until just tender (45-60 minutes).
  3. Drain beans and transfer to a casserole dish. Add diced red onion, garlic, tomato sauce/paste, honey, dill, olive oil, salt, black pepper, cayenne pepper, red wine vinegar, and water.
  4. Mix thoroughly and transfer to a lined baking sheet.
  5. Bake at 350 degrees Fahrenheit for about an hour until bubbly and caramelized.
  6. Stir to mix in any floating olive oil. Garnish with crumbled feta, olive oil, and fresh dill.
  7. Serve and enjoy! Optional: Serve with roasted meats or as a vegetarian dish.
